COUNTESS, GORDON.
GORDON
(rushes in out of breath)
'Tis a mistake!
'Tis not the Swedes; ye must proceed no further—
Butler! Oh, God! where is he?
   [Observing the COUNTESS.
Countess! Say——
COUNTESS.
You're come then from the castle? Where's my husband?
GORDON
(in an agony of affright).
Your husband! Ask not! To the duke——
COUNTESS.
Not till
You have discovered to me——
GORDON.
On this moment
Does the world hang. For God's sake! to the duke.
While we are speaking——
   [Calling loudly.
Butler! Butler! God!
